The Fight for Capital: Turkey ISE-30 Research into Investor Relations and Disclosure Best Practice
Acclaro, Dec 2009
Vast improvement is needed if Turkey wants to attract fresh capital from Institutional Investors as they look to invest in a post-recession world.
The first ever in-depth study into the practices of Turkey’s leading listed companies
Based on the benchmark criteria of Turkey’s Investor Relations Awards, this is the first time that a detailed study of the investor relations practices of Turkey’s leading companies has ever conducted.
It has been conducted in partnership with the Institute of Directors, the world’s leading authority on professional standards in Boardroom Disclosure & Transparency.
The study is an invaluable analysis tool for Turkish companies who need to improve their investor relations practices and achieve international best practice.
Global investors depend on strong and effective investor relations departments. This study provides a timely and invaluable opportunity for Turkish companies to benchmark themselves against their local and emerging market peers, and learn how they can meet the same best practice standards as practiced by mature market corporations.
The study uses an unprecedented propriety methodology of over 240 criteria. It will tell you in invaluable detail:
- If the company’s board is really disclosing all its actions and whether they being transparent - Exactly what information you will find (or won’t find) in their annual reports - Which information is available on their investor relations website and how up-to-date it is - If it is merely complying with it’s Corporate Governance practices or achieving best-practice - If the company is clearly and regularly communicating its financial performance
